Publication date Topics Academy Awards This volume focuses on the Academy Awards ceremony and other events connected with it. Each chapter contains an overview of the film year.
pages: 25 cm. This volume focuses on the Academy Awards ceremony and other events connected with it. Each chapter contains an overview of the film year. It gives dates for each annual ceremony, location, host, who presented the major awards that year, as well as who performed the nominated songs. The authors cover the ceremony itself from the entrances, where stars display their gowns and escorts, to the handing out of the awards. Mason Wiley, co-author of one of the definitive works on the Academy Awards, has died in New York City. Gilbert Cole, his longtime companion, said that Wiley was 39 when he died from the complications of AIDS on Oct. 7. Wiley had been seriously ill for about two years. With fellow Columbia University classmate Damien Bona, Wiley in wrote a year-by-year account of the fantasies and foibles of the Oscar presentations.
